Job description

Job responsibilities

Key Responsiblities

- Conduct thorough patient assessments, including taking medical histories and performing physical examinations.

- Diagnose and manage acute and chronic health conditions, developing appropriate treatment plans.

- Order and interpret diagnostic tests, lab results, and imaging studies.

- Provide health promotion, disease prevention, and education to patients and their families.

- Collaborate with the healthcare team to coordinate patient care and improve health outcomes.

- Prescribe medications and manage follow-up care as needed.

- Participate in quality improvement initiatives and contribute to the development of practice protocols.

- Mentor and educate junior staff and students, fostering a learning environment.

Person Specification

Qualifications

Essential

  • Masters degree in Advanced Clinical Practice
  • V300 Prescribing Qualification

Desirable

  • Minimum of 3 years of clinical experience in a primary care or general practice setting.
  • Experience in diagnosing and managing acute and chronic health conditions.

Disclosure and Barring Service Check

This post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ions.

UK Registration

Applicants must have current UK professional registration. For further information please see NHS Careers website (opens in a new window).
